Subject: Handover — Quillstream markdown pipeline

Hi all, handing over release duties for the Quillstream rendering pipeline to Marisol. A few notes for future maintainers: the sanitizer stage must always run before the embed expander, or raw HTML can leak into previews. Release tags are built on the Larkspur runner and signed automatically; never sign locally. If you need to re-provision the runner after an outage, register it with the pipeline's deploy key, which is included below for continuity.

signing key of bagap-yawep = bky13_TbfT6ZMUoGJo2

## Feedcheck Validator: Capacity Note

For the upcoming Birchline release: the Feedcheck podcast validator polls registered feeds on a fixed cadence, and capacity is bounded by concurrent fetches and per-feed parse timeouts. At projected feed growth, headroom holds through next quarter provided the limits below stay unchanged. Any increase requires a fleet resize first. The governing constants are as follows.

tuning table, yajog-yahof:
BUDGETS = {
    "lamvan": 303,
    "wenox": 460,
    "fenvan": 525,
}

### Changelog — Week 42

Consent banner rollout (Project Wrenfold): banner is now live for 100% of traffic in the staged regions, up from 25% last week. Opt-out persistence bug from the 25% cohort is fixed; dismissal state now survives session refresh. Remaining work: localization for the two outstanding locales and cleanup of the legacy cookie shim, targeted for next sprint. No incidents attributed to the rollout this week. Point of contact for rollout questions is listed below.

named custodian: Brivan Eliath Quenox Frador

### Step 4: Timezone Handling

Report exports in Ledgerleaf previously assumed the Harwick office timezone, which caused off-by-one-day totals for overseas teams. The new exporter stores all timestamps in UTC and converts at render time. Before running the migration script, update your exporter instance with the settings shown below.

service settings:
PRAIX_LOG_LEVEL=error
PRAIX_METRICS_HOST=metrics.praix.qorvelcorp.corp
PRAIX_POOL_SIZE=16